US Patent No.: 8,282,619 B2
Inventor(s): Christopher Peter Olson, Neenah, Wis., US; Lawrence Howell Sawyer, Neenah, Wis., US; and Raymond Gerard St. Louis, Fremont, Wis., US.
Company: Kimberly-Clark Worldwide, Inc., Neenah, Wis., US.
Filed: 7/13/10
Issued: 10/9/12
A pant-like absorbent garment, comprising: an absorbent chassis defining a waist opening and first and second leg openings, the absorbent chassis including a bodyside liner, an outer cover that defines an exterior surface of the absorbent garment, and an absorbent assembly enveloped in between the bodyside liner and the outer cover, the bodyside liner, the outer cover and the absorbent assembly being integrally assembled together; the absorbent chassis having a longitudinal length and the waist opening having a circumference, such that the longitudinal length is proportional to the circumference of the waist opening according to the relation: Length≤(Circumference+128)/1.6, wherein the circumference of the waist opening is measured at 500 grams tension, the garment has a thickness of less than about 4.5 millimeters, and a front elastic waist member and a rear elastic waist member are operatively joined to the outer cover, the body side liner, or both.
